Professional experience : - Advising foreign investors on the advantages and disadvantages of various investment vehicles in China including equity and cooperative joint ventures
- Preparing feasibility study reports, joint venture contracts, articles of association and other documents relating to the establishment of equity or cooperative joint ventures
- Representing clients in their acquisition of equity interest in joint ventures
- Advising clients generally on doing business in China on issues such as setting up of representative office, employment of expatriates and local staff, management and control, settlement of disputes
- Advising banks in Hong Kong on lending to borrowers who provide PRC properties or plant and machinery in China as security
- Preparing loan agreement, mortgage contract of PRC properties, guarantee, and other related documents
- Preparing documentation relating to the sale and purchase and mortgage of PRC properties
- Preparing tenancy agreements and supplementary documents for PRC properties
- Preparing master documents to be entered into between bank and developers for the guarantee of repayment of mortgage loans by mortgagors
- Preparing standard mortgage contract and submitting the same to local notary public's office and Housing Administration Bureau for pre-approval
- Preparing general commercial documents including distribution agreements, licensing agreements, agent agreements and consultancy service contracts
